The Science Behind Ru Ware's Frost Veins ("Crackle Patterns")
1. Fundamental Causes - Thermal Stress: • Clay (α=5.4×10⁻⁶/°C) & glaze (α=7.1×10⁻⁶/°C) coefficient mismatch • Generated during cooling from 1300°C→200°C at ~15°C/min rate - Crystalline Growth: • Mullite (3Al₂O₃·2SiO₂) needles form at 1100-1250°C • Agate particles create localized stress points...

The History and Evolution of Ru Ware Celadon
1. Origins (Northern Song Dynasty: 960-1127 AD) - Imperial Commission: • Founded circa 1086 under Emperor Huizong's decree • Exclusive to royal court for 40 years (1086-1126) - Legendary Standard: • "Sky-after-rain" glaze color mandated by imperial poem • Only...
